Abstract
A rubber plastic open-type LED light box includes a rectangular frame, wherein, a light emitting diode light conducting plate is fixedly mounted in the rectangular frame, each edge of the rectangular frame is connected with a strip turning plate, the strip turning plates are mounted along the inner side of the rectangle frame and locate at the front lateral surface of the light emitting diode light conducting plate, a locking mechanism is respectively provided between each strip turning plate and the rectangle frame. The locking mechanism is composed of a raised line mounted on the strip turning plate and a groove mounted on the rectangle frame. Compared with the prior technology, the utility model has positive and significant effect. The utility model sets up the light emitting diode light conducting plate in the rectangular frame, which can realize active lighting from the behind of pictures and avoids the affect of the external environment light source and objects. At the same time, movable turning plates are provided at the surroundings of the rectangle frame, which is convenient for retaining and replacing pictures, thereby the use will be more convenient.

Background technology:
Generally adopt photo frame to show photo, picture in the prior art.Photo frame is made of housing, backer board and the preceding light-passing board of rectangle, backer board and preceding light-passing board are installed in the rectangle housing, photo or picture are placed between backer board and the preceding light-passing board, photo frame itself does not possess lighting device, the illumination of dependence external light source, therefore, the display quality of photo or picture is subjected to the influence of external light source easily, than the image of bright object, influence the display effect of photo or picture around also can reflecting in the preceding light-passing board.In addition, the mount of housing, back of the body village's plate and preceding light-passing board is loaded down with trivial details, places or take out photo, picture inconvenience.
